PAS climbs as ADSL, cable feed Chinese high-speed
In a recent study, Chinese Telecom Market: Overview and Analysis, Parks Associates forecasts some 13 million Chinese broadband users – as opposed to subscribers – for end-2003. The U.S. research outfit gives ADSL a 60% share of the broadband-access market, followed by fiber-to-the-building (FTTB) + Ethernet at 20%.
